1.3 PRELIMINARY RECOMMENDATIONS

DANGER!
Always disconnect the general power supply before changing any electric
component associated to the inverter. Many components may remain loaded
with high voltages and/or moving (fans), even after the AC power supply is
disconnected or turned off. Wait for at least ten minutes in order to guarantee
the full discharge of the capacitors. Always connect the grounding point of the
inverter to the protection grounding.
NOTE!
The MW500 inverter may interfere in other electronic equipment. To
minimize these effects, carefully follow the recommendations of
INSTALLATION AND CONNECTION on page
Read the entire manual before installing or operating this inverter.
Do not execute any applied withstand voltage test on the inverter!
ATTENTION!
The electronic boards have components sensitive to electrostatic discharges.
Do not touch the components or connectors directly. If necessary, first touch
the grounding point of the inverter, which must be connected to the protection
ground or use a proper grounding strap.
ATTENTION!
Do not touch the frame of the inverter directly. The inverter may be very hot
during and after the operation.
ATTENTION!
When in operation, electric energy systems – such as transformers, converters,
motors and cables – generate electromagnetic fields (EMF), posing a risk to
people with pacemakers or implants who stay in close proximity to them.
Therefore, those people must stay at least 2 meters away from such equipment.
